Re: Official Information Act Request #2458
I refer to your Official Information Act request received on 11 August 2022 in which you
specifically requested the following:
How many, if any, first year medical and nursing students at Otago University have
been asked to complete fill-in shifts at Dunedin Hospital, and if so what remuneration
opportunities have they been offered?
We can confirm on the weekend of the 23 July 2022 and 24 July 2022, five, first year Otago
Polytechnic nursing students volunteered to do a shift each at Dunedin Hospital covering
patient watches.
They were each given a $200 New World grocery voucher as Koha for the shift.
